Heavy rains and storms in many areas in the northeast caused destruction there. In Assam, people’s homes and crops were damaged due to sudden heavy rains, storms and hailstorms. The storm also caused huge damage in Tripura. By the time of writing the news, damage to more than 616 houses had been reported. Tripura’s Sipahijala district was mostly affected by the storm.
More than 616 houses were damaged across Tripura after heavy rains and a storm lashed the state on Sunday. According to a detailed report by the State Emergency Operations Center in Agartala, 37 houses were completely damaged, 125 were severely damaged and 454 houses were partially damaged.
According to reports, out of the eight districts in the country, Sipahijala district was the worst affected, with around 392 houses damaged, including 23 houses in Jampujala sub-division, 14 houses in Sonmura sub-division and 355 houses in Bishlegarh sub-division. are included. Apart from Sepahijala district, 14 houses were partially damaged in Unakoti, 124 houses in Dalai district, 21 houses in West district, 33 houses in Khawai, 24 houses in Gomti and only 8 houses were damaged in South district.
